3. Executive Committee Business

3.1 First Stage – Road Races (Amendment) Bill (NIA 29/11-15)

The Minister for Regional Development, Mr Danny Kennedy, introduced a Bill to amend the Road Races (Northern Ireland) Order 1986 to provide for contingency days to be specified in an order authorising the use of roads in connection with road races and for the substitution of a contingency day for a day specified in such an order.

The Road Races (Amendment) Bill (NIA 29/11-15) passed First Stage and ordered to be printed.

4. Private Members’ Business

4.1 Motion – Recall of the Civic Forum

Proposed:

That this Assembly notes its decision of 9 April 2013 on the recall of the Civic Forum and the lack of progress to date; further notes that there are over 500 submissions to “Haass/O’Sullivan” from civic organisations, victims groups, individuals and the wider community, and the authority of that input; believes that the Civic Forum can further capture this input, thereby building inclusion and helping to remedy the failures of politics; and calls on the First Minister and deputy First Minister to recall the Civic Forum by the end of January 2014.

Mr A Attwood
Mrs D Kelly
Mr C Eastwood

Debate ensued.

The Question being put, the Motion was carried (Division 1).

6. Private Members’ Business (Cont’d)

6.1 Motion – Police Ombudsman's Office

Proposed:

That this Assembly notes the consultation paper from the Department of Justice on the Powers of the Police Ombudsman's Office; and calls on the Minister of Justice to bring forward proposals that will ensure an effective organisation that commands broad public support.

Mr D McIlveen
Mr J Wells
Mr P Givan
Mr J Craig

6.2 Amendment 1

Proposed:

Leave out all after ‘will’ and insert:

‘build on the powers and effectiveness of the organisation, including statutory requirements in relation to the co-operation of current and former police service personnel with the investigations of the Police Ombudsman.’

Mrs D Kelly
Mr A Attwood

6.3 Amendment 2

Proposed:

Leave out all after ‘organisation’ and insert:

‘which is properly resourced and fully independent; and further calls on all members of the public or public authorities with information which would assist investigations by the Police Ombudsman to bring forward that information and co-operate fully with the Office.’

Mr G Kelly
Mr R McCartney
Ms C Ruane

Debate ensued.

The Question being put, Amendment No. 1 fell (Division 2).

The Question being put, Amendment No. 2 fell (Division 3).

The Question being put, the Motion was carried without division.
